Default Power steering fluid

2006 rx 33o 45000 miles....when to change power steering fluid ?

The owners manual indicates, for Canada, every 64000km/40000 miles. So you are due if you follow the owners manual. For this I use synthetic transmission fluid

I do a drain (more of suck up) and fill Dexron III every oil change. Keeps the PS fluid pinkish.
